Ethereum Releases Glamsterdam Devnet-6 as Testing Progresses
- Development Network Progress: Ethereum's release of Glamsterdam Devnet-6 marks a critical testing phase for its protocol upgrade, allowing development teams to validate new code in a controlled environment to address potential issues before mainnet deployment.
- Importance of Iterative Testing: Each Devnet iteration aims to identify and resolve bugs and compatibility issues, and the release of Devnet-6 indicates significant progress in Ethereum's largest protocol overhaul, boosting confidence among developers and infrastructure operators.
- Risk Mitigation Strategy: Ethereum's upgrade process follows a sequence from development networks to public testnets and then to mainnet, with the successful implementation of Devnet-6 helping to identify interoperability issues, thereby reducing the risks associated with mainnet upgrades.
